A first half penalty strike from Ebere Ngozi ensured that
Rivers Angels defeated Confluence Queens 1-0 in an exhibition match played at
the FIFA Goal Project Technical Centre in Abuja on Tuesday.
The exhibition match saw a much improved Confluence Queens team
against Rivers Angels, although experience counted at the end of the match
duration.
Ijeoma Obi rattled the woodwork, before lanky striker Ijeoma
Emenike blazed over on 4 minutes.
Henry Grace then dribbled her way past Confluence Queens
defense line, but she was denied by the sharp reflexes of Oluwaseun Bello.
Former Rivers Angels striker Lola Philips combined well with
Damilola Koku to force Charity John to a save in the 11th minute.
Rivers Angels were soon in front when Ijeoma Emenike
wriggled free before she was brought down by Tosin Emmanuel.
Ebere Ngozi easily dispatched the spot-kick on 14th minute
for the star-studded Rivers Angels team.
Confluence Queens upped their game, with Captain Tobiloba
Olarewaju, Rosemary Okoro and Carine Yoh going close with their efforts.
The second half started much livelier and Oluwaseun Bello
was called to duty in the early parts.
Rivers Angels goalie Charity John produced a diving save to
deny Lola Philips mid-way through the second half.
Confluence Queens' technical crew threw on exciting forward
Aishat Bello in search of an equalizer and the golden chance arrived two
minutes from time when the skillful youngster dribbled her way to the box, but
she fired a tame shot straight at Charity John.
Rivers Angels and Pelican Stars were supposed to have played
a champion of champions challenge to determine the winners of the 2013/14
Nigeria Women Premier League season, but the Calabar based team pulled out of
the match.
Edwin Okon tutored Angels were crowned official champions of
the 2013/14 season after the exhibition match with the trophy handed to Glory
Iroka by Nigeria Women Football League board member Mr Peter Oguche.
